react-cropper
Advanced tools
Comparing version 0.10.1 to 0.12.0
@@ -15,2 +15,6 @@ 'use strict'; | ||
var _propTypes = require('prop-types'); | ||
var _propTypes2 = _interopRequireDefault(_propTypes); | ||
var _reactDom = require('react-dom'); | ||
@@ -292,40 +296,40 @@ | ||
ReactCropper.propTypes = { | ||
style: _react.PropTypes.object, | ||
className: _react.PropTypes.string, | ||
style: _propTypes2.default.object, | ||
className: _propTypes2.default.string, | ||
// react cropper options | ||
crossOrigin: _react.PropTypes.string, | ||
src: _react.PropTypes.string, | ||
alt: _react.PropTypes.string, | ||
crossOrigin: _propTypes2.default.string, | ||
src: _propTypes2.default.string, | ||
alt: _propTypes2.default.string, | ||
// props of option can be changed after componentDidmount | ||
aspectRatio: _react.PropTypes.number, | ||
dragMode: _react.PropTypes.oneOf(['crop', 'move', 'none']), | ||
data: _react.PropTypes.shape({ | ||
x: _react.PropTypes.number, | ||
y: _react.PropTypes.number, | ||
width: _react.PropTypes.number, | ||
height: _react.PropTypes.number, | ||
rotate: _react.PropTypes.number, | ||
scaleX: _react.PropTypes.number, | ||
scaleY: _react.PropTypes.number | ||
aspectRatio: _propTypes2.default.number, | ||
dragMode: _propTypes2.default.oneOf(['crop', 'move', 'none']), | ||
data: _propTypes2.default.shape({ | ||
x: _propTypes2.default.number, | ||
y: _propTypes2.default.number, | ||
width: _propTypes2.default.number, | ||
height: _propTypes2.default.number, | ||
rotate: _propTypes2.default.number, | ||
scaleX: _propTypes2.default.number, | ||
scaleY: _propTypes2.default.number | ||
}), | ||
scaleX: _react.PropTypes.number, | ||
scaleY: _react.PropTypes.number, | ||
enable: _react.PropTypes.bool, | ||
cropBoxData: _react.PropTypes.shape({ | ||
left: _react.PropTypes.number, | ||
top: _react.PropTypes.number, | ||
width: _react.PropTypes.number, | ||
hegiht: _react.PropTypes.number | ||
scaleX: _propTypes2.default.number, | ||
scaleY: _propTypes2.default.number, | ||
enable: _propTypes2.default.bool, | ||
cropBoxData: _propTypes2.default.shape({ | ||
left: _propTypes2.default.number, | ||
top: _propTypes2.default.number, | ||
width: _propTypes2.default.number, | ||
hegiht: _propTypes2.default.number | ||
}), | ||
canvasData: _react.PropTypes.shape({ | ||
left: _react.PropTypes.number, | ||
top: _react.PropTypes.number, | ||
width: _react.PropTypes.number, | ||
hegiht: _react.PropTypes.number | ||
canvasData: _propTypes2.default.shape({ | ||
left: _propTypes2.default.number, | ||
top: _propTypes2.default.number, | ||
width: _propTypes2.default.number, | ||
hegiht: _propTypes2.default.number | ||
}), | ||
zoomTo: _react.PropTypes.number, | ||
moveTo: _react.PropTypes.arrayOf(_react.PropTypes.number), | ||
rotateTo: _react.PropTypes.number, | ||
zoomTo: _propTypes2.default.number, | ||
moveTo: _propTypes2.default.arrayOf(_propTypes2.default.number), | ||
rotateTo: _propTypes2.default.number, | ||
@@ -335,37 +339,37 @@ // cropperjs options | ||
// aspectRatio, dragMode, data | ||
viewMode: _react.PropTypes.oneOf([0, 1, 2, 3]), | ||
preview: _react.PropTypes.string, | ||
responsive: _react.PropTypes.bool, | ||
restore: _react.PropTypes.bool, | ||
checkCrossOrigin: _react.PropTypes.bool, | ||
checkOrientation: _react.PropTypes.bool, | ||
modal: _react.PropTypes.bool, | ||
guides: _react.PropTypes.bool, | ||
center: _react.PropTypes.bool, | ||
highlight: _react.PropTypes.bool, | ||
background: _react.PropTypes.bool, | ||
autoCrop: _react.PropTypes.bool, | ||
autoCropArea: _react.PropTypes.number, | ||
movable: _react.PropTypes.bool, | ||
rotatable: _react.PropTypes.bool, | ||
scalable: _react.PropTypes.bool, | ||
zoomable: _react.PropTypes.bool, | ||
zoomOnTouch: _react.PropTypes.bool, | ||
zoomOnWheel: _react.PropTypes.bool, | ||
wheelZoomRation: _react.PropTypes.number, | ||
cropBoxMovable: _react.PropTypes.bool, | ||
cropBoxResizable: _react.PropTypes.bool, | ||
toggleDragModeOnDblclick: _react.PropTypes.bool, | ||
minContainerWidth: _react.PropTypes.number, | ||
minContainerHeight: _react.PropTypes.number, | ||
minCanvasWidth: _react.PropTypes.number, | ||
minCanvasHeight: _react.PropTypes.number, | ||
minCropBoxWidth: _react.PropTypes.number, | ||
minCropBoxHeight: _react.PropTypes.number, | ||
ready: _react.PropTypes.func, | ||
cropstart: _react.PropTypes.func, | ||
cropmove: _react.PropTypes.func, | ||
cropend: _react.PropTypes.func, | ||
crop: _react.PropTypes.func, | ||
zoom: _react.PropTypes.func | ||
viewMode: _propTypes2.default.oneOf([0, 1, 2, 3]), | ||
preview: _propTypes2.default.string, | ||
responsive: _propTypes2.default.bool, | ||
restore: _propTypes2.default.bool, | ||
checkCrossOrigin: _propTypes2.default.bool, | ||
checkOrientation: _propTypes2.default.bool, | ||
modal: _propTypes2.default.bool, | ||
guides: _propTypes2.default.bool, | ||
center: _propTypes2.default.bool, | ||
highlight: _propTypes2.default.bool, | ||
background: _propTypes2.default.bool, | ||
autoCrop: _propTypes2.default.bool, | ||
autoCropArea: _propTypes2.default.number, | ||
movable: _propTypes2.default.bool, | ||
rotatable: _propTypes2.default.bool, | ||
scalable: _propTypes2.default.bool, | ||
zoomable: _propTypes2.default.bool, | ||
zoomOnTouch: _propTypes2.default.bool, | ||
zoomOnWheel: _propTypes2.default.bool, | ||
wheelZoomRation: _propTypes2.default.number, | ||
cropBoxMovable: _propTypes2.default.bool, | ||
cropBoxResizable: _propTypes2.default.bool, | ||
toggleDragModeOnDblclick: _propTypes2.default.bool, | ||
minContainerWidth: _propTypes2.default.number, | ||
minContainerHeight: _propTypes2.default.number, | ||
minCanvasWidth: _propTypes2.default.number, | ||
minCanvasHeight: _propTypes2.default.number, | ||
minCropBoxWidth: _propTypes2.default.number, | ||
minCropBoxHeight: _propTypes2.default.number, | ||
ready: _propTypes2.default.func, | ||
cropstart: _propTypes2.default.func, | ||
cropmove: _propTypes2.default.func, | ||
cropend: _propTypes2.default.func, | ||
crop: _propTypes2.default.func, | ||
zoom: _propTypes2.default.func | ||
}; | ||
@@ -372,0 +376,0 @@ |
{ | ||
"name": "react-cropper", | ||
"version": "0.10.1", | ||
"version": "0.12.0", | ||
"description": "Cropper as React components", | ||
@@ -33,3 +33,4 @@ "main": "dist/react-cropper.js", | ||
"dependencies": { | ||
"cropperjs": "^0.8.0" | ||
"cropperjs": "^0.8.0", | ||
"prop-types": "^15.5.8" | ||
}, | ||
@@ -36,0 +37,0 @@ "peerDependencies": { |
Sorry, the diff of this file is not supported yet
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
159532
437
4
+ Addedprop-types@^15.5.8